Le matrici, analizzerai
Ora è il momento di sporcarsi le mani. Nei seguenti esercizi analizzerai gli incassi del franchise di Star Wars. Che la forza sia con te!
Nell'editor vengono definiti tre vettori. Ognuno di essi rappresenta i numeri degli incassi dei primi tre film di Star Wars. Il primo elemento di ogni vettore indica gli incassi degli Stati Uniti, il secondo elemento si riferisce agli incassi non statunitensi (fonte: Wikipedia).
In questo esercizio, combinerai tutte queste cifre in un unico vettore. Successivamente, costruirai una matrice a partire da tale vettore.
Questo esercizio fa parte del corso
Introduzione a R
Istruzioni dell'esercizio
- Usa
c(new_hope, empire_strikes, return_jedi)
per combinare i tre vettori in un unico vettore, che chiameraibox_office
. - Costruisci una matrice con 3 righe, dove ogni riga rappresenta un film. Per farlo, utilizza la funzione
matrix()
. Il primo argomento è il vettorebox_office
, contenente tutti gli incassi al botteghino. Poi dovrai specificarenrow = 3
ebyrow = TRUE
. Nomina la matrice risultantestar_wars_matrix
.
Esercizio pratico interattivo
Prova questo esercizio completando il codice di esempio.
# Box office Star Wars (in millions!)
new_hope <- c(460.998, 314.4)
empire_strikes <- c(290.475, 247.900)
return_jedi <- c(309.306, 165.8)
# Create box_office
box_office <-
# Construct star_wars_matrix
star_wars_matrix <-